Informatics (Exam 1)
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| adverse drug event (ADE) | An injury caused from a medical intervention that is linked to a medication. |
| clinical decision making | An iterative process using nursing knowledge to assess a client situation, identify the priority concern, then use evidence-based interventions to implement care. |
| clinical information system | Computer systems that allow for instant retrieval of client information either directly or from data networks. |
| clinical pathways | A standardized method of health care delivery for a specific group of clients through the use of practices based on evidence-based guidelines. |
| digital health literacy | The ability to search, obtain, understand, and evaluate information from electronic sources and utilize that knowledge to manage a health issue. |
| electronic health record (EHR) | Systemic, digitized documentation system used to improve medical records. A computerized, real-time form of a client's paper chart that can be shared between members of the interprofessional team |
|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) | Legislation to protect coverage and private information of clients. Its purpose is to protect client's privacy and personal health information from security breaches, particularly electronic data. |
| health literacy | The ability to obtain, read, and understand health-related information |
| informatics | The use of information and technology to communicate, manage knowledge, mitigate error, and support decision-making. |
| information technology | Technology and physical devices used to create and store information, including electronic health records. |
| medication error | Preventable error capable of causing harm or death to a client under the care of a health care provider. |
| protected health information (PHI) | Any information held by a covered entity that can be linked to an individual. |
| quality improvement | A systematic process of analyzing care practices to maintain the highest levels of client care and outcomes. |
| simulation | Is a method used to create a situation that mimics a real experience and is used for the practice, assessment, education, or to acquire knowledge of system's or a person's actions. |
| telehealth | The provision of both clinical and nonclinical aspects of health care delivery through the use of telecommunication devices such as the internet and telephone. |
